In an intense and nail-biting grand finale on August 5, 2026, social media influencer and reality TV star Shreya Kalra emerged as the champion of Lock Upp Season 2. Hosted by Farah Khan and Riteish Deshmukh on Netflix, the captive reality show concluded its high-drama 40-day run as Kalra edged out popular television actress Shivangi Joshi by a razor-thin margin of just seven votes. Along with the iconic trophy, Kalra walked away with the grand cash prize of ₹1 crore.

A High-Stakes Finale and Tactical Showdown

The grand finale night tested the top five contestants—Shreya Kalra, Shivangi Joshi, Yogesh Rawat, Shilpa Shinde, and Ram Kapoor—through rigorous tasks and intense grilling sessions. Ram Kapoor was the first to be eliminated after failing a crucial puzzle task, followed by Shilpa Shinde in fourth place.

The top three finalists then faced direct questioning from a jury of media professionals and industry personalities. Following Yogesh Rawat's eviction in third spot, the final showdown narrowed down to Kalra and Joshi. Hosts Farah Khan and Riteish Deshmukh revealed that after tabulating votes from the ex-inmates, jailers, and studio jury, Kalra clinched the title by a hair's breadth.
